Comprehensive Guide to Glass Door Repairs

Glass doors are a streamlined and modern choice for both residential and commercial areas, however they can be prone to various kinds of damage, such as cracks, scratches, or total breakage. Repairing a glass door is essential not just for visual reasons however likewise for safety and energy effectiveness. This post will detail the common issues confronted with glass doors, the repair processes included, and some preventative maintenance suggestions to keep them looking their finest.

Kinds Of Glass Doors

Before diving into repairs, it's essential to understand the numerous kinds of glass doors that exist:

  1. Sliding Glass Doors: Common in patios and balconies, these doors slide open and closed on a track.
  2. French Doors: These double doors frequently have glass panes and can swing either in or out.
  3. Bi-fold Doors: Made of numerous panels that fold versus one another, these doors provide broadened openings.
  4. Entry Doors with Glass Inserts: These doors usually have a solid wood or metal frame but may feature glass styles for decor.

Comprehending the kind of glass door involved assists evaluate the repair methods necessary.

Typical Issues and Repairs

1. Broken or Broken Glass

Issue: Cracked or shattered glass is among the most typical issues with glass doors, often resulting from accidents, extreme temperature changes, or incorrect installation.

Repair Process:

  • Assess Damage: Determine if the entire pane needs replacement or if small repairs can be enough.
  • Security First: Wear protective equipment (gloves, safety goggles) to avoid injury from sharp glass shards.
  • Remove Broken Glass: Carefully take out any shattered pieces and clean the frame.
  • Install New Glass Pane: Measure and cut a brand-new piece of glass, then install it with suitable glazing to ensure a protected fit.

2. Scratches

Problem: Scratches on glass doors can end up being unpleasant and may impact openness.

Repair Process:

  • Clean the Area: Use glass cleaner to remove dirt and grime.
  • Usage Glass Polish: Apply a glass polishing item to rub out small scratches.
  • When it comes to Deep Scratches: If scratches are too deep, you may need to replace the glass pane entirely.

3. Misaligned Sliding Doors

Problem: Sliding glass doors can sometimes end up being misaligned, causing them to get stuck or not close appropriately.

Repair Process:

  • Inspect the Track: Check for particles or blockages in the track.
  • Adjust Rollers: Use a screwdriver to adjust the rollers and make sure the door moves smoothly.
  • Lubricate: Apply lubricant to the track to relieve the sliding procedure.

4. Misting Between Glass Panes

Issue: If a double-paned glass door establishes a foggy look, it suggests that the seal has actually stopped working, enabling wetness to go into.

Repair Process:

  • Seal Replacement: Complete seal replacement is typically necessary by eliminating the affected panes and resealing the edges effectively.
  • Replacement of Glass: In some cases, replacing the whole door or pane might be more cost-effective than repairs.

5. Harmed Hardware

Problem: Handles, locks, and hinges can wear out or break.

Repair Process:

  • Inspection: Look for loose screws, rust, or broken components.
  • Replacement Parts: Order replacements from the producer and install them according to instructions.
  • Regular Maintenance: Lubricate locks and hinges routinely to prevent tightness or malfunctioning.

Preventative Maintenance Tips

Preventing damage to glass doors can conserve time, cash, and the hassle of repairs. Here are some proactive care techniques:

  • Regular Cleaning: Use non-abrasive glass cleaners to preserve cleanliness.
  • Routine Inspections: Check seals, tracks, and hardware frequently for early signs of wear.
  • Weatherproofing: Use weatherstripping to prevent drafts and moisture from permeating the glass.
  • Adjust Rollers Annually: Especially for moving doors, inspect and adjust rollers to prevent long-lasting misalignment.

Frequently asked questions

What are the signs that my glass door needs repair?

Common signs consist of fractures in the glass, trouble opening or closing, fog in between the panes, and harmed hardware.

Can I repair my glass door myself?

Numerous small repairs, such as changing handles or cleaning scratches, can be done independently. However, substantial issues like pane replacement ought to be managed by specialists.

How long does it require to repair a glass door?

Simple repairs like re-aligning tracks can take as little as an hour, while complete pane replacements can need a few hours or more depending upon the complexity of the task.

Exist any security worry about glass doors?

Yes, broken glass poses a danger of injury, and improperly installed doors can compromise security. Constantly utilize professional services for substantial repairs or replacements.

How can I keep financial investment in my glass doors?

Regular maintenance, evaluations, and timely repairs can extend the life of your glass doors considerably and keep their aesthetic appeal.
